Resurrecting the thread only because I had the same question and called K&N about it. The rep told me that the only difference was that the 57 series comes with the CARB sticker. Everything else is EXACTLY the same. If you happen to have a 63 series FIPK, you can still get a hold of the CARB sticker by filling out a form and taking a picture of the intake on your car or receipt of purchase. You must also take a picture of the VIN number on your door jam to prove that you have a 2.2L/AP2 (only the 2.2L is CARB certified, not the 2.0L) along with a photocopy of your vehicle registration.
